Out of the last decade or so, what would you say has been your favorite movie released, and then what was your favorite scifi movie? Bonus points for books too :0c
My favorite book of the last decade was, without a doubt, Ancillary Justice. (I feel like I’ve become terribly repetitive when it comes to books - I can converse pretty well about current SF/F, but it always comes back to Ancillary Justice.)
Oooh boy, movies are tougher. Star Wars will always own my heart, so The Force Awakens is exempt from the competition by virtue of its close personal relationship with the judge. That leaves Fury Road, which won me over with its sandy, rapid-fire, but crystal clear action scenes. For non-franchise movies I really liked Pacific Rim and The Host (Bong Joon-ho).
I feel like I’m forgetting something less bombastic, although my taste does run toward monsters…
Oh! Midnight Special, a beautiful piece of weird Americana with Adam Driver.
